The Importance of Location: Choosing the Perfect Area for Your Furnished Apartment in Hong Kong

Location is the key to determining your living experience while looking for the ideal furnished apartment in Hong Kong. Hong Kong is a vibrant, busy city with various areas, each with special benefits. When choosing the ideal location for your residence, you should take into account a variety of factors, such as the neighborhood’s proximity to your place of employment or academic study, mobility and modes of transportation, the range of services, preferred lifestyle, the price of living, society vibe, educational institutions, upcoming developments, pollution and noise levels, and security and privacy.

By carefully weighing these factors, you can ensure that the geographical location of your new home meets your demands and improves your overall quality of life.

4 Reasons Why Location is Important

  1. Proximity to Daily Necessities

Your ability to access necessary facilities and services depends on where you rent an apartment. It is easy to satisfy your everyday requirements when you live near food shops, pharmacies, medical facilities, educational institutions, and public transit. A convenient location improves your comfort and standard of life by reducing the time and effort required for commuting, performing errands, and accessing essential services.

  1. Transit and Commuting

The location of your residence might considerably impact your daily commute. Consider the area concerning your place of employment or study and the accessibility of public transit. Living near a bus stop, railway station, or busy road may reduce commute time and costs. A good location also simplifies going about the city and discovering the neighborhood.

  1. Safety and Security

When renting a flat, the neighborhood’s security is of utmost importance. To establish a safe living environment, research the local level of crime and safety precautions.

Consider variables like street illumination, the availability of security workers, and community attentiveness when choosing a site with a good reputation for safety. For your mental and physical health, it is important that you feel secure in your environment.

  1. Lifestyle and Recreation

The location of your leased residence might considerably impact your daily activities and recreational options. Think about parks, recreational areas, retail centers, dining options, and entertainment options while choosing a place for you. Your hobbies and preferences are matched by living in a community with a thriving social scene and a wide range of recreational possibilities, giving you plenty of chances to discover and take advantage of your free time.

Key Factors to Consider When Selecting the Area for Your Furnished Apartment

  1. Facilities and Services

Seek places with various amenities, such as grocery stores, shopping centers, restaurants, hospitals, and leisure areas. Your convenience and standard of life are enhanced when these facilities are nearby or can be reached quickly by car.

  1. Cost of Living

The cost of living in different parts of Hong Kong varies. Some areas may have more expensive rental rates, particularly those in the city core or with a view of the sea. Establish your spending limit and balance the location’s budget and appeal.

  1. Neighborhood and Expat-friendly Areas

If you are an expat or want a neighborhood with many expatriates, consider Central, Sheung Wan, Wan Chai, or Mid-levels. These neighborhoods often feature a sizable expat population and provide services and facilities geared toward inhabitants from other countries.

  1. Educational Facilities

Depending on whether you have kids, find out whether schools or other educational facilities are nearby. To guarantee that your children obtain an excellent education, think about the reputation and standards of the neighboring schools.

  1. Future Development

Pay attention to any upcoming or existing construction endeavors in the region. Future construction may raise home prices, amenities, and availability. Conversely, they could also bring about brief disturbances while working.

  1. Noise and Pollution

Hong Kong, a busy city, may have significant noise and air pollution levels, particularly in regions with dense populations or close to busy roadways. When selecting the site, take your tolerance for noise and air quality into account.

Conclusion

When selecting the ideal neighborhood for your furnished apartment in Hong Kong, location cannot be overstated. Your living situation, level of convenience, and general quality of life may all be significantly improved by the correct location. The suitability of a location is greatly influenced by a variety of factors, including proximity to places of employment or study, ease of getting transportation, accessibility of facilities, peace of mind, preferences for lifestyles, living cost, community ambiance, educational institutions, future growth, and noise and air quality levels.
